We recently shared an article from Forbes Magazine called “Why Restaurants Will Not Just Survive But Thrive After The Pandemic.” The following passage really stuck out to us in light of current times:

 

…In the aftermath of Katrina, New Orleans gained restaurants. Where there had been 984 restaurants in the city before the hurricane, there are now more than 1,300, an increase of about 30%.

 

This is not to say that restauranteurs aren’t facing unprecedented struggles, but just that growth and creativity is going to blossom in the years to come out of these challenges.
